Skip to content

Commit ef9ee9a

Browse files
Fixes version reader in demo config installer
Signed-off-by: Darshit Chanpura <dchanp@amazon.com>
1 parent b295ff8 commit ef9ee9a

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

src/main/java/org/opensearch/security/tools/democonfig/Installer.java

+2-1
Original file line numberDiff line numberDiff line change
@@ -342,7 +342,8 @@ void setSecurityVariables() {
342342
);
343343

344344
if (securityFiles != null && securityFiles.length > 0) {
345-
SECURITY_VERSION = securityFiles[0].getName().replaceAll("opensearch-security-(.*).jar", "$1");
345+
SECURITY_VERSION = securityFiles[0].getName()
346+
.replaceAll("opensearch-security-(\\d+(\\.\\d+)*(-[a-zA-Z0-9]+)?(-SNAPSHOT)?).jar", "$1");
346347
}
347348
}
348349

0 commit comments

Comments
 (0)